Output 1542285e8cd16f5a64f74a1bb15c3c7913059e45a2e75f53b5f98a9d307bd40f:1

value
57354092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c89309e51c8d057f22db9a5cf935e9e439faad OP_EQUAL
address
3B4V8G9ZgF8S7313yFBSmzigs2krswQgX7
transaction
1542285e8cd16f5a64f74a1bb15c3c7913059e45a2e75f53b5f98a9d307bd40f
spent
true